Abstract
A base station transmits by a group of antennas arranged two-dimensionally along a horizontal direction and a vertical direction, a data signal weighted for each antenna and transmits by first plural antennas arranged along the horizontal direction, a first reference signal weighted corresponding to the data signal and specific to a mobile station. The base station transmits a second reference signal that is common to mobile stations, via second plural antennas arranged along the vertical direction at positions corresponding to some of the first plural antennas. The base station transmits weight information that indicates a weight for the data signal for each of the antennas arranged along the vertical direction. The mobile station demodulates the data signal transmitted by the base station, based on the first reference signal, the second reference signal, and the weight information transmitted by the base station.
